Safe Powerboat Handling Drivers Education for BoatersTM US Coast Guard & NASBLA Approved This 16-hour hands-on, on-the-water course is for anyone who wants to learn how to safely operate a powerboat or improve their on-the-water boat handling skills. No experience necessary. The topics are covered using a variety of techniques in the classroom and dockside, emphasizing on-the-water practical application of all skills. Topics covered include: On-the-Water Sessions: Engine & electrical systems Starting procedures Docking Leaving & returning to a slip Close-quarters maneuvers Anchoring Steering a range Proceeding to a destination Person in water rescue Classroom Sessions: Safety, prep & weather Maneuvering concepts Registration & capacities Equipment requirements Prep & fueling procedures Navigation rules of the road Aids to navigation Environmental regulations
